ICP Australia introduces iEi’s FLEX-BX200, which is an AI hardware-ready system suitable for deep learning inference computing to help the user achieve fast, deep insights into their customers and business. The product supports graphics cards, Intel FPGA acceleration cards and Intel VPU acceleration cards, and provides additional computational power plus an end-to-end solution to run tasks efficiently. With the NVIDIA TensorRT, QNAP QuAI and Intel OpenVINO AI development toolkit, users can deploy solutions quickly.
The FLEX series offers four 2.5″ HDD bays with a high-speed SATA 6 Gbps interface that can expand storage capabilities and enable fast data transfers. The equipped Intel Q370 chipset provides high-performance hardware RAID protection for the user to back up their media and critical information. RAID 0/1/5/10 can be configured from the BIOS menu to increase performance and/or provide automatic protection against data loss from drive failure.
The series supports multiple PCIe slots, including two PCIe 3.0 x8 and two PCIe 3.0 x4 slots — which are compatible with standard low-profile add-on cards — to meet different edge inference computing applications. It is integrated with the Intel Coffee Lake Desktop processor and supports an HDMI 1.4 output port delivering 4K 24 Hz with a high level of detail. A single HDMI cable carries both video and audio signals, which makes deployment particularly easy.
